About weather on the Camino Olvidado

The Camino Olvidado, or "Forgotten Way," provides an inviting opportunity to traverse northern Spain's tranquil landscapes. This lesser-known route is especially enjoyable during months like April, May, and September, when the weather tends to be more favorable for walking. With such varied climates across the year, understanding the seasonal changes along the trail aids in planning an enriching journey.

  • Spring (Mar–May): Spring presents a mix of sunny spells, varied temperatures, and occasional rainy periods, enhancing the route's natural beauty.
  • Summer (Jun–Aug): Over the summer, the trail experiences warm days with intermittent rain, while conditions remain largely comfortable and dynamic.
  • Autumn (Sep–Nov): Autumn features alternating rainy and sunny days, with temperatures varying widely as the trail traverses different elevations.
  • Winter (Dec–Feb): The winter months bring diverse weather, from frequent rainfall to potential snowfall, along with notable temperature fluctuations.
